NEW DLEHI:  With the inevitability of a petrol price hike looming large, Congress leaders are of the view that the government should "bite the bullet" now rather than later.
    
"Crude oil prices have touched a new high and oil companies are in the red. It is being felt that the government should go in for the petrol price hike now rather than some months later," a senior Congress leader said.
    
A large section of the Congress feels that if the price hike is deferred, it could have a greater impact on the party's prospects in the Lok Sabha elections.
    
"So, it would be advisable to bite the bullet now," the leader said.
    
Among the options available before the government is going in for a mix of measures like increasing the fuel prices, imposing a cess and reducing excise and customs duties on import of oil.
    
For the record, the party said the government should opt for a way that puts the least burden on the common man.
    
"There are two to three proposals on dealing with the situation. The government should take steps that put the least burden on the common man," AICC spokesperson Manish Tewari said.
